Preparing for work
Before starting the construction of the foundation, it is necessary to carefully calculate the work plan. It is important to determine the location of the facility, the area and orientation of the process points. An approximate layout of the shed will allow you to correctly position the supporting platform, regardless of what technology it will be performed. So that the foundation for the shed lasts longer and is not damaged in the first stages of operation due to defects in the surface of the earth, it is important to perform soil clearance. The layer of vegetation must be eliminated and, if possible, make the rough coating not only smooth, but also hard. Perhaps this will also require the removal of a loose layer of soil or the use of a tamper tool. The way to achieve the desired characteristics of the base surface will depend on the quality of the soil itself.
Solution preparation
Almost all methods of building a foundation for a barn require the use of concrete. To prepare the solution, you need a basic set of water, sand and cement, but with the addition of gravel. The fraction of its elements can be any, but it is desirable to correlate it with the volume of the planned mass - the larger the pouring area, the larger the fraction. For example, gravel for a columnar foundation will have a minimum size, and for a strip foundation it is advisable to select a large fraction. It is important to observe the proportions for the solution from which the foundation for the barn will be made . Do it yourself in a small container, mix sand with gravel in a ratio of 3: 5, after which add 1 part Portland cement. Water is added with the expectation of a thick, but tenacious mass.
Monolithic foundation device

This is a simple technique, but quite a voluminous way to complete the foundation. Its use is justified when it comes to the construction of a brick farm building. The essence of the technology is to create a durable sand cushion with the inclusion of the same gravel. Approximately 10-15 cm, a foundation should be arranged on which a cement screed will be arranged in the future. But before that, a solid formwork is formed around the perimeter of the working area, on which it is planned to establish the foundation for the shed. Do-it-yourself restrictive barriers are made, within which cement mortar will be poured. They can be made of plastic or wooden battens with panels - the main thing is that they can hold the filled mass. After that, you can proceed to the installation of reinforcing bars and the direct device of the screed. It should be borne in mind that the full acquisition of the strength of such a foundation can take about 2-3 weeks, depending on the working area.
How to make a foundation for a column-type barn?
A column foundation requires less materials in volume, but its implementation implies a more thorough calculation. Usually a support base is formed, fixed on racks mounted in the ground. If we are talking about a small barn, then four pillars with a diameter of about 15 cm will be quite enough. For each of them, a hole is originally rummaged in which a pillow of gravel and sand is filled. Next, the column rod is installed and poured with cement. If necessary, you can use special equipment for driving piles. After that, the columnar foundation for the barn is covered with lags. The basis for the flooring will be formed by fastening structures, including the binding of the grillage, channel and profile elements.
The technique of the device foundation strip
This type of foundation is one of the most common in the construction of residential private houses, but for household buildings it is considered too troublesome and unreasonably costly. To implement this technique, it is necessary to make pit lines along the perimeter of the working platform. You will get trenches that are covered with sand and gravel. For greater reliability, a reinforcing base is also carried out in earthen niches. If a strip foundation is planned for a large-area barn, then trenches should also be made in the central part. Next, prepared niches with fittings are poured with the same solution. After hardening the concrete, you can begin work on the device flooring, which can simultaneously act as a floor covering of the future barn.
How to make a foundation for a shed of foam blocks?
Two methods of constructing a platform for a shed from a foam block are common. In the first case, it is supposed to create contour bearing lines according to the type of strip foundation. That is, a trench is made around the perimeter, which is filled with a combination of sand and gravel, after which blocks are laid on the cement mortar. Next, a connecting structure is formed for the flooring from metal or durable lags. The second method is used in working with objects that are demanding in terms of resistance to high loads. In this scheme, the performer lays the foundation in blocks all over the site. The foam block itself is characterized by low thermal conductivity, insulating qualities, ease of processing and low price. Therefore, from the point of view of obtaining high operational qualities of the shed as a repository of materials demanding for maintenance, this foundation option may be the best.
How to choose the best option for the foundation?
Before analyzing possible options for a suitable foundation, you should decide on the tasks that the barn will perform and the conditions for its operation. For a small building in a warm region, a pile foundation with several supporting rods will be enough. It is advisable to build large-scale objects on a monolithic basis - for example, from a solid concrete screed or in the form of a block platform. These techniques will make it possible to build a durable and well protected foundation in the lower part under the shed. Do-it-yourself monolith is implemented by a standard set of tools, but requires more physical effort. For example, laying a block may require the help of one partner, at a minimum.
Is it possible to build a shed without a foundation?
Of course, it will not be possible to do completely without a bearing base, but the optimization of this structural part of the barn in some cases justifies itself. So, if there are no strict requirements for thermal insulation, then it is quite possible to limit ourselves to installing a frame on four concrete blocks, scattered around the corners of a future building. You can make a shed without foundation and on cleared soil. Such projects are usually implemented using prefabricated structures, which provide a rigid wood or metal platform, replacing the foundation. But it is important not to forget that the classic foundation also guarantees horizontal surface. Therefore, it is important to initially adjust the draft coating so that it does not have serious deviations in altitude over the entire area.
